Amending the U.S.-Switzerland Double Taxation Agreement
P R O T O C O L
———
AMENDING ARTICLE 26 OF THE CONVENTION BETWEEN THE UNITED STATES OF AMERICA AND THE SWISS CONFEDERATION FOR THE AVOIDANCE OF DOUBLE TAXATION WITH RESPECT TO TAXES ON INCOME, SIGNED AT WASHINGTON ON OCTOBER 2, 1996
THE UNITED STATES OF AMERICA
AND
THE SWISS CONFEDERATION
Desiring to conclude a Protocol to amend the Convention between the United States of America and the Swiss Confederation for the Avoidance of Double Taxation with respect to Taxes on Income, signed at Washington on October 2, 1996 (hereinafter referred to as the "Convention"),
Have agreed as follows:
Article 1
Paragraph 2 of Article 26 (Exchange of Information) of the Convention shall be deleted and replaced by the following provisions:
"2. Any information received under paragraph1i by a Contracting State shall be treated as secret in the same manner as information obtained under the domestic laws of that State and shall be disclosed only to persons or authorities (including courts and administrative bodies) involved in the administration, assessment or collection of, the enforcement or prosecution in respect of, or the determination of appeals in relation to the taxes referred to in paragraph 1, or the oversight of such functions. Such persons or authorities shall use the information only for such purposes. They may disclose the information in public court proceedings or in judicial decisions. Notwithstanding the foregoing, information received by a Contracting State may be used for other purposes when such information may be used for such other purposes under the laws of both States."
Article 2
1. This Protocol shall be subject to ratification in accordance with the applicable procedures of each Contracting State and instruments of ratification shall be exchanged as soon as possible.
2. This Protocol shall enter into force upon the exchange of instruments of ratification. Its provisions shall have effect:
a) in respect of exchange of information on or after the first January of the year following the entry into force of this Protocol;
DONE at Washington, in duplicate, this [DATE], in the English and German languages, the two texts having equal authenticity.
